Step-by-step explanation:
We know that the sum of the measures of angles on one side of the parallelogram is 180°.
We have the equation:
(6x - 12) + (132 - x) = 180
6x - 12 + 132 - x = 180 <em>combine like terms</em>
(6x - x) + (-12 + 132) = 180
5x + 120 = 180 <em>subtract 120 from both sides</em>
5x = 60 <em>divide both sides by 5</em>
x = 12
Opposite angles in the parallelogram are congruent.
Therefore:
6y + 18 = 6x - 12
Put the value of x to the equation and solve it for y:
6y + 18 = 6(12) - 12
6y + 18 = 72 - 12
6y + 18 = 60 <em>subtract 18 from both sides</em>
6y = 42 <em>divide both sides by 6</em>
y = 7
